Far Cry 5 DLC Features Zombies, Aliens, Jungle Warfare & Far Cry 3 Classic Edition

Far Cry 5 focuses on the battle to free Hope County, Montana from the grip of The Project at Eden’s Gate cult, but its post-launch content will take gamers far beyond rural America. The Far Cry 5 Season Pass includes access to three new expansions.

In Dead Living Zombies, you’ll struggle to survive in a zombie-infested wasteland, facing off against hordes of the undead. In Hours of Darkness, you’ll trade gunfire with Vietcong fighters in Vietnam, while Lost on Mars takes you to the titular red planet to test your mettle against Martian arachnids.
